How much fiber is in frozen yogurt cone, chocolate, waffle cone?
frozen Yogurt Cone, Chocolate, Waffle Cone delivers 5.9 grams of dietary fiber in a typical 1 cone serving, which makes it a good source of fiber. That covers roughly 21% of a 28 gram daily reference intake, so it can make a real dent in your fiber goal for the day.
Of that total, an estimated 1.2 g is soluble fiber (which forms a gel in the gut and helps with cholesterol and blood-sugar) and an estimated 4.7 g is insoluble fiber (which adds bulk and supports regularity).
USDA FoodData Central FNDDS 2021-2023; FDC ID 2705462; total dietary fiber nutrient 1079. Total fiber is from USDA FNDDS; soluble and insoluble grams are category-based estimates, not lab-measured values.
